David Grose

Index David Grose

David F. Grose (November 21, 1944 – October 13, 2004) was an American archaeologist and Professor of Classics and Archaeology at the University of Massachusetts Amherst. [1]

Cosa

Cosa was a Latin colony founded in southwestern Tuscany in 273 BC, on land confiscated from the Etruscans, to solidify the control of the Romans and offer the Republic a protected port.
